Used BMW 2 Series cars for sale in Wellingborough, Northamptonshire

Loading...
Make (any)
Model (any)
Min price (any)
Max price (any)

Find your perfect used BMW 2 Series for sale in Wellingborough or on finance from our extensive local network of car supermarkets, specialist, independent and officially franchised BMW dealerships.

BMW, 2 Series

2021 - 218i [2.0] M Sport 2dr [Nav] Step Auto

36
£15,649
Finance available £317 pm
  • 2L
  • 49kMiles
  • Petrol
  • Semi Auto
  • Body StyleCoupe

cinch Warehouse Corby

01536 219125 *
4.3/5 Stars

BMW, 2 Series

2024 - 220i MHT M Sport 5dr DCT

35
Low Mileage
£30,990
  • 1.5L
  • 7.2kMiles
  • Petrol
  • Auto
  • Body StyleHatchback

Stratstone BMW Milton Keynes

01908 104093 *
4.6/5 Stars

BMW, 2 Series

2024 - 218i [136] M Sport 4dr DCT

12
£27,898
  • 1.5L
  • 11.1kMiles
  • Petrol
  • Auto
  • Body StyleSaloon

Arnold Clark Click & Collect Milton Keynes

0141 611 8716 *
4.6/5 Stars

BMW, 2 Series

2024 - M235i xDrive 4dr Step Auto

35
£28,950
  • 2L
  • 22kMiles
  • Petrol
  • Auto
  • Body StyleSaloon

Stratstone BMW Milton Keynes

01908 104093 *
4.6/5 Stars

BMW, 2 Series

2023 - 225e xDrive Luxury 5dr DCT

12
Low Mileage
£29,998
  • 1.5L
  • 6.6kMiles
  • Hybrid
  • Auto
  • Body StyleHatchback

Arnold Clark Click & Collect Milton Keynes

0141 611 8716 *
4.6/5 Stars

BMW, 2 Series

2017 (67) - 218i M Sport 5dr Step Auto

20
Low Mileage
£14,490
Finance available £301 pm
  • 1.5L
  • 51kMiles
  • Petrol
  • Semi Auto
  • Body StyleEstate

Empire Cars Bedford

01234 237238 *
4.9/5 Stars

BMW, 2 Series

2020 - M235i xDrive 4dr Step Auto [Tech/Pro Pack]

53
Low Mileage
£22,917
  • 2L
  • 31.1kMiles
  • Petrol
  • Semi Auto
  • Body StyleSaloon

Marshall Volvo Milton Keynes

BMW, 2 Series

2015 (65) - 2.0 220d Sport Auto Euro 6 (s/s) 2dr

61
£7,990
Finance available £156 pm
  • 2L
  • 121kMiles
  • Diesel
  • Auto
  • Body StyleConvertible

Auto Globe Limited

01908 765760 *
4.7/5 Stars

BMW, 2 Series

2017 - M240i 2dr [Nav] Step Auto

35
£16,750
  • 3L
  • 69.6kMiles
  • Petrol
  • Auto
  • Body StyleConvertible

Stratstone BMW Milton Keynes

01908 104093 *
4.6/5 Stars

BMW, 2 Series

2024 - 220i M Sport 4dr Step Auto

35
Low Mileage
£30,250
  • 2L
  • 4.4kMiles
  • Petrol
  • Auto
  • Body StyleSaloon

Stratstone BMW Milton Keynes

01908 104093 *
4.6/5 Stars

BMW, 2 Series

2024 - M Sport Auto 0-Door

35
Low Mileage
£37,950
  • 2L
  • 4.6kMiles
  • Petrol
  • Auto
  • Body StyleCoupe

Stratstone BMW Milton Keynes

01908 104093 *
4.6/5 Stars

BMW, 2 Series

2020 - M235i xDrive 4dr Step Auto

35
£22,990
  • 2L
  • 49.1kMiles
  • Petrol
  • Auto
  • Body StyleSaloon

Stratstone BMW Milton Keynes

01908 104093 *
4.6/5 Stars

BMW, 2 Series

2021 - 218i [2.0] M Sport 2dr [Nav] Step Auto

35
Low Mileage
£22,250
  • 2L
  • 15.7kMiles
  • Petrol
  • Auto
  • Body StyleConvertible

Stratstone BMW Milton Keynes

01908 104093 *
4.6/5 Stars

BMW, 2 Series

2016 (16) - 218i M Sport 2dr

53
Low Mileage
£9,490
Finance available £190 pm
  • 1.5L
  • 64kMiles
  • Petrol
  • Manual
  • Body StyleCoupe

Podium PCL

BMW, 2 Series

2024 - 225e xDrive M Sport 5dr DCT

35
Low Mileage
£32,950
  • 1.5L
  • 6.9kMiles
  • Auto
  • Body StyleHatchback

Stratstone BMW Milton Keynes

01908 104093 *
4.6/5 Stars

BMW, 2 Series

2016 (66) - 2.0 220d Sport Auto Euro 6 (s/s) 2dr

41
£6,750
Finance available £128 pm
  • 2L
  • 127.7kMiles
  • Diesel
  • Auto
  • Body StyleCoupe

BINCA Retail